Sativa_vs_Rada_Moment news May 15, 2023 fciwomenswrestling.com femcompetititor.com grapplingstars.com, Antscha Productions screen shot Continue Reading Previous International Ground Struggle, England’s Sativa Vs Belarus Rada, Stealth Sensations